École des Beaux-Arts de Paris

The École des Beaux-Arts de Paris is a prestigious art and architecture school in France, founded in 1671. It has historically trained many influential architects, painters, and sculptors. The school emphasizes classical techniques, craftsmanship, and a comprehensive understanding of arts and design, combining rigorous technical training with artistic expression. Its notable alumni include renowned artists like Monet and Matisse. While it has evolved over centuries, it remains a symbol of high-level artistic education and contributes significantly to France’s cultural and artistic heritage.
